INSTALLATION

2-1. INSPECTION.

2-2. The set was carefully inspected both mechanically and electrically before shipment. It should be physically free of mars or scratches and in perfect electrical condition on receipt. To confirm this, the set should be inspected for physical damage in transit, for supplied accessories and for electrical performance. Paragraph 5-7outlines the electrical performance checks using test equipment listed in Table 5-1.If there is damage or deficiency, see the warranty in the front of this manual.

2-3. WARRANTY EXCEPTION.

2-4. The battery supplied with the 3555B is warranted for a period of 60 days, beginning at the time of receipt of the set. This warranty is based on an expected battery life of 180 hours at 4 hours per day at 700 F as specified in Table 1-1in this Manual.

2-10. BATTERY.

2-6. This set is designed to operate from an internal 45 volt dry cell battery, an external 24 to 48 volt CO battery or from an ac power source (115/230V, 48 to 440Hz). The power source is selected by the AC/BAT switch on the side of the, set. The line voltage is selected by the 115/230 volt slide switch on the rear of the set. The set is protected by a 0.1 5A slow-blow fuse.

2-7. THREE-CONDUCTOR POWER CABLE.

2-8. To protect operating personnel, the National

Electrical Manufacturers' Association (NEMA) recommends that the panel and cabinet be grounded. This set is equipped with a three-conductor power cable which, when plugged into an appropriate receptacle, grounds the set. The offset pin on the power cable three-prong connector is the ground wire. This power cable is detachable from the set and is stored inside the front cover.

2-9. Figure 2-1illustrates the standard power plug configurations that are used throughout the United States and in other countries. The -hp- part number shown directly below each plug drawing is the part number for a 3555B power cord equipped with the proper plug. If the appropriate power cord is not included with the instrument, notify the nearest Hewlett- Packard office and a replacement cord will be provided.

2-11. This set is operated from a single NEDA 202 45V dry cell internal battery or an external 48V CO battery when the power selection switch, on the side of the case, is in the DIAL/BAT position. Inserting a Western Electric plug into the battery jack disconnects the internal battery. (See Table 2-1for batteries suitable for use in this instrument.
